			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;When you play the game however you can’t help but notice that Bayonetta reminds you a lot of Devil May Cry,</p>
<p>You do realise that the Bayonetta system was designed by Hideki Kamiya? You know, the guy who came up with the system for Devil May Cry. It&#8217;s HIS system so shouldn&#8217;t he be free to iterate it as he likes, how do you come up with the notion that it&#8217;s a &#8220;rip-off&#8221;?</p>
<p>Also, Bayonetta does not have a meter which rates your attacks, it uses a completely different system to Devil May Cry&#8217;s Stylish Rank. The Bayonetta combo system is closer to what you would see in a traditional vertical or horizontal shooter. The combo system is time based; you have 3 seconds in which to land another hit in order to keep a combo &#8220;active&#8221;, repeating attacks results in a score penalty which can be reset by using certain specific actions. The longer you keep a combo &#8220;active&#8221;, the higher you build your combo multiplier, it is a very different system to what was established in Devil May Cry.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>CS:GO is a copy of cod? Oh jeez besides the fact that CS has been out longer than cod the two are a lot different.  CS uses hip shooting whereas cod uses iron sights.  CS doesn&#8217;t have pointless kill streaks, perks, and regenerating health from crouching in a corner.  CS uses an economy system where you have to spend money on guns, nades, etc.  Cod uses a leveling system and rewards players for playing the game longer with better perks, skins, etc.  Search and Destroy came from the Bomb Defusal (de_) mode in CS, not the other way around.</p>
